The Cybernetic Cryptid's Lament
The neon lights of Neo-Tokyo flickered erratically as they cast an eerie glow upon the dilapidated rooftop. The air was thick with the hum of distant hovercrafts and the distant wail of a siren, a symphony of urban chaos. On this rooftop, nestled between the sprawling cityscape and the starless night sky, stood a figure shrouded in the shadows—a cybernetic creature known as Kuro.
Kuro's body was a patchwork of organic flesh and sleek metal, the product of a world where ancient ones and futuristic technology had collided. The creature's eyes, glowing with an inner light, had once been human, a testament to a life that had been cut short by the very technology that now sustained it. Kuro's mission was as old as the cities themselves: to uncover the truth behind the mysterious signal that had been emanating from the heart of Tokyo for weeks.
The signal was unlike any other. It resonated with a power that Kuro felt deep within its metallic core, a power that seemed to pulse with the rhythm of the ancient ones—a race of beings whose existence was as shrouded in myth as it was in fear. The signal was a call, a siren's song that drew Kuro from the darkness into the heart of Tokyo's underbelly.
Kuro had been created for one purpose: to serve as a sentinel against the ancient ones. But something had changed within Kuro—a spark of something that was not programmed into its circuits. A spark of... curiosity. A spark of... love.
It was love that had led Kuro to the ruins of the old Tokyo Station, a place where the past and the future collided in a symphony of rust and neon. Here, Kuro met Yumi, a young hacker whose eyes held the same spark of curiosity. Yumi's presence was like a breath of fresh air, a reminder of the human soul that had once lived within Kuro's own eyes.
Yumi, too, was on a quest, a quest to unravel the mystery of the signal. She had been tracking it for weeks, her fingers dancing across the keys of her cyberdeck like a maestro conducting an orchestra. The signal had brought her to the old Tokyo Station, a place she knew all too well—the site of her first encounter with the ancient ones.
The signal was a beacon, a promise of something greater than themselves, something that Yumi and Kuro had both felt in their bones. But as they delved deeper into the mysteries of the ancient ones, they discovered that the signal was not a call to power, but a call to love—a love that transcended time, space, and even the boundaries between life and death.
Together, Yumi and Kuro faced a series of trials that tested their resolve and their very understanding of the world. They encountered cultists, corporate spies, and the remnants of the ancient ones themselves. Each encounter brought them closer to the truth, but also closer to their own mortality.
In the heart of the ancient ones' temple, hidden beneath the ruins of the Tokyo Station, Yumi and Kuro uncovered the source of the signal—a massive, crystalline structure that pulsed with a life force beyond their comprehension. It was within this structure that Kuro found the truth about its creation—the ancient ones had created Kuro and Yumi as a bridge between their world and the human one, to serve as guardians and as lovers.
But the ancient ones were dying, their power waning with each passing moment. Kuro and Yumi were the only ones who could save them, but at a great cost. They must choose between the ancient ones and their own love, between life and death, between the past and the future.
As the ancient ones' temple began to crumble around them, Kuro and Yumi stood side by side, their hearts pounding with a rhythm that matched the pulse of the ancient ones. In a final act of love and sacrifice, Yumi and Kuro merged their essences with the ancient ones, becoming one with the signal that had called them to this fate.
The temple shattered, and with it, the ancient ones were freed from their bondage. Kuro and Yumi were transformed, their essence forever intertwined with the ancient ones, their love transcending all boundaries. They were reborn, no longer bound by the limitations of flesh and metal, but as beings of pure energy and love.
As the world around them was reshaped by the ancient ones' newfound freedom, Kuro and Yumi stood together, a testament to the power of love and the unyielding spirit of the human heart. The signal had called them, and in answering, they had found their purpose and their redemption.
And so, in a world where technology and ancient powers danced together, Kuro and Yumi stood as a beacon of hope, a reminder that love could overcome even the most daunting of challenges. The call of the ancient ones had not only been answered, but it had been transformed, forever changing the fabric of reality.
